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
AT90S2343-10PC

AT90S2343-10PC

Product Overview

Category

AT90S2343-10PC bel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ic devices and systems for controlling and processing data.

Characteristics

  • High-performance microcontroller with advanced features
  • Low power consumption
  • Compact size
  • Versatile and flexible in its applications

Package

AT90S2343-10PC is available in a standard DIP (Dual In-line Package) format.

Essence

The essence of AT90S2343-10PC lies in its ability to provide efficient control and processing capabilities in a wide range of electronic applications.

Packaging/Quantity

AT90S2343-10PC is typically packaged in tubes or trays, with a quantity of 25 units per package.

Specifications

  • Microcontroller Model: AT90S2343-10PC
  • Operating Voltage: 2.7V - 5.5V
  • Clock Speed: 10 MHz
  • Flash Memory: 2 KB
  • RAM: 128 bytes
  • I/O Pins: 18
  • ADC Channels: 8
  • Communication Interfaces: SPI, UART, I2C
  • Timers/Counters: 2
  • PWM Channels: 4
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

  1. VCC - Power supply voltage
  2. GND - Ground
  3. XTAL1 - Crystal oscillator input
  4. XTAL2 - Crystal oscillator output
  5. RESET - Reset pin
  6. PORTB0 - General-purpose I/O pin
  7. PORTB1 - General-purpose I/O pin
  8. PORTB2 - General-purpose I/O pin
  9. PORTB3 - General-purpose I/O pin
  10. PORTB4 - General-purpose I/O pin
  11. PORTB5 - General-purpose I/O pin
  12. PORTB6 - General-purpose I/O pin
  13. PORTB7 - General-purpose I/O pin
  14. VCC - Power supply voltage
  15. GND - Ground
  16. PORTD0 - General-purpose I/O pin
  17. PORTD1 - General-purpose I/O pin
  18. PORTD2 - General-purpose I/O pin

Functional Features

  • High-speed processing capabilities
  • On-chip flash memory for program storage
  • Built-in ADC for analog signal conversion
  • Multiple communication interfaces for data exchange
  • Timers and counters for precise timing operations
  • PWM channels for generating analog output signals

Advantages and Disadvantages

Advantages

  • Compact size allows for integration into small-scale electronic devices
  • Low power consumption prolongs battery life in portable applications
  • Versatile features enable a wide range of applications
  • Cost-effective solution for many embedded systems

Disadvantages

  • Limited program and data memory compared to higher-end microcontrollers
  • Relatively lower clock speed may limit performance in demanding applications

Working Principles

AT90S2343-10PC operates based on the principles of digital logic and microcontroller architecture. It executes instructions stored in its flash memory, processes input signals, and generates output signals accordingly. The microcontroller's internal components, such as the ALU (Arithmetic Logic Unit), registers, and peripherals, work together to perform various tasks and control external devices.

Detailed Application Field Plans

AT90S2343-10PC finds applications in various fields, including but not limited to: - Home automation systems - Industrial control systems - Automotive electronics - Medical devices - Consumer electronics - Robotics

Detailed and Complete Alternative Models

Some alternative models that offer similar functionality to AT90S2343-10PC are: - ATmega328P - PIC16F877A - STM32F103C8T6 - MSP430G2553

These alternative models provide comparable features and can be used as replacements depending on specific requirements.

In conclusion, AT90S2343-10PC is a versatile microcontroller with advanced features suitable for a wide range of electronic applications. Its compact size, low power consumption, and flexible functionality make it an attractive choice for embedded systems designers.

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ací AT90S2343-10PC v technických řešeních

Sure! Here are 10 common questions and answers related to the application of AT90S2343-10PC in technical solutions:

  1. Q: What is the AT90S2343-10PC microcontroller used for? A: The AT90S2343-10PC is a microcontroller commonly used in embedded systems for various applications such as robotics, automation, and control systems.

  2. Q: What is the operating voltage range of the AT90S2343-10PC? A: The AT90S2343-10PC operates within a voltage range of 2.7V to 5.5V.

  3. Q: How much flash memory does the AT90S2343-10PC have? A: The AT90S2343-10PC has 2KB of flash memory for program storage.

  4. Q: Can I use the AT90S2343-10PC for real-time applications? A: Yes, the AT90S2343-10PC can be used for real-time applications as it has a built-in timer/counter and interrupt capabilities.

  5. Q: Does the AT90S2343-10PC support analog inputs? A: No, the AT90S2343-10PC does not have built-in analog-to-digital converters (ADCs). External ADCs can be used if analog inputs are required.

  6. Q: What communication interfaces are supported by the AT90S2343-10PC? A: The AT90S2343-10PC supports serial communication through its USART (Universal Synchronous/Asynchronous Receiver/Transmitter) interface.

  7. Q: Can I connect external memory to the AT90S2343-10PC? A: No, the AT90S2343-10PC does not have external memory interface capabilities. It has limited on-chip RAM for data storage.

  8. Q: What is the maximum clock frequency of the AT90S2343-10PC? A: The AT90S2343-10PC can operate at a maximum clock frequency of 10 MHz.

  9. Q: Is the AT90S2343-10PC suitable for low-power applications? A: Yes, the AT90S2343-10PC has power-saving features such as sleep modes and power-down modes, making it suitable for low-power applications.

  10. Q: Can I program the AT90S2343-10PC using a standard programmer? A: Yes, the AT90S2343-10PC can be programmed using a standard in-circuit serial programmer (ISP) or parallel programmer compatible with Atmel microcontrollers.

Please note that these answers are general and may vary depending on specific requirements and application scenarios.